Wednesday, September 30th, 2009
Last Thursday (September 24, 2009) a fire was reported in a biodisel plant near Osceola County in Florida. The biodiesel plant was owned by New Eden Energy. There were no fatalities or injuries.

Sunday, February 1st, 2009
Biofuel production and manufacturing facilities in the United States are increasing rapidly. On August 8, 2005, President Bush signed the Energy Policy Act of 2005 (H.R. 6) into law. The comprehensive energy legislation includes a nationwide renewable fuels standard (RFS) that will double the use of ethanol and biodiesel by 2012.
